Antonio Rojas pushed to branch main at Arch Linux / Packaging / Packages / 
pianobar


Commits:
5f24deee by Antonio Rojas at 2024-05-25T21:39:29+02:00
upgpkg: 2022.04.01-3: ffmpeg 7 rebuild

- - - - -


2 changed files:

- + .SRCINFO
- PKGBUILD


Changes:

=====================================
.SRCINFO
=====================================
@@ -0,0 +1,20 @@
+pkgbase = pianobar
+       pkgdesc = Console-based frontend for Pandora
+       pkgver = 2022.04.01
+       pkgrel = 3
+       url = https://6xq.net/pianobar/
+       arch = x86_64
+       license = MIT
+       depends = libao
+       depends = ffmpeg
+       depends = curl
+       depends = json-c
+       source = https://6xq.net/pianobar/pianobar-2022.04.01.tar.bz2
+       source = https://6xq.net/pianobar/pianobar-2022.04.01.tar.bz2.asc
+       source = https://github.com/PromyLOPh/pianobar/commit/8bf4c1bb.patch
+       validpgpkeys = 017D74E27F5856963801781DF663943E08D8092A
+       sha256sums = 
1670b28865a8b82a57bb6dfea7f16e2fa4145d2f354910bb17380b32c9b94763
+       sha256sums = SKIP
+       sha256sums = 
ab8f7539189a21064b1773551b393df16c34a371d23f38bf5394ca7b6e0ec411
+
+pkgname = pianobar


=====================================
PKGBUILD
=====================================
@@ -5,16 +5,23 @@
 
 pkgname=pianobar
 pkgver=2022.04.01
-pkgrel=2
+pkgrel=3
 pkgdesc="Console-based frontend for Pandora"
 arch=('x86_64')
 url="https://6xq.net/pianobar/";
 license=('MIT')
 depends=('libao' 'ffmpeg' 'curl' 'json-c')
-source=(https://6xq.net/pianobar/$pkgname-$pkgver.tar.bz2{,.asc})
+source=(https://6xq.net/pianobar/$pkgname-$pkgver.tar.bz2{,.asc}
+        https://github.com/PromyLOPh/pianobar/commit/8bf4c1bb.patch)
 validpgpkeys=('017D74E27F5856963801781DF663943E08D8092A') # Lars-Dominik Braun 
<l...@6xq.net>
 sha256sums=('1670b28865a8b82a57bb6dfea7f16e2fa4145d2f354910bb17380b32c9b94763'
-            'SKIP')
+            'SKIP'
+            'ab8f7539189a21064b1773551b393df16c34a371d23f38bf5394ca7b6e0ec411')
+
+prepare() {
+  cd $pkgname-$pkgver
+  patch -p1 -i ../8bf4c1bb.patch # Fix build with ffmpeg 7
+}
 
 build() {
   make -C ${pkgname}-${pkgver}



View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/pianobar/-/commit/5f24deee492b3e2b3ffdf61c1fb7e0a7cb25777a

-- 
View it on GitLab: 
https://gitlab.archlinux.org/archlinux/packaging/packages/pianobar/-/commit/5f24deee492b3e2b3ffdf61c1fb7e0a7cb25777a
You're receiving this email because of your account on gitlab.archlinux.org.


Reply via email to